Pellworm
Pellworm is a municipality in the district of Nordfriesland, in Schleswig-Holstein, Germany. The municipality is located on the island of Pellworm – one of the North Frisian Islands on the North Sea coast of Germany.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Südfall
Hamlet
Photo: Jom, CC BY-SA 2.0 de.
Südfall is a small island in the Wadden Sea off the west coast of Schleswig-Holstein, Germany, one of the ten German Hallig islands. It has a permanent population of two people. Südfall is situated 8 km southeast of Pellworm.
